I made this card to send to some members of my demonstrator group, known as the “Eh” Team, so I used the dies and the Foam Adhesive Sheets to customize the card by adding the EH! I cut the 2020-2022 In Colour Designer Series Paper [DSP] to fit my card front, and then stuck the remaining scraps of the DSP onto a Foam Adhesive Sheet. I was able to cut through the DSP and sheet using the dies, and then positioned them onto the front of the card.

I stamped the “sparkle” stamp in Bumblebee ink onto the Bumblebee cardstock, and die cut some scalloped circles from the Layering Circles Dies in Very Vanilla and Misty Moonlight. I could have used the Stamparatus to stamp the sentiment, but because the Pattern Play stamp is photopolymer, I just used a clear block because I can actually see through the stamp (and block) to where I am stamping.
